Pool cleaning device
A pool cleaning device includes a debris collection member having a forward displacement unit connected thereto. The debris collection member includes a generally rectangular-shaped frame having a mesh net suspended therefrom. A pole receiver is positioned along the rear wall of the frame and interacts with a pole to receive a pushing and/or pulling force from a user. The forward displacement unit includes a leading edge member having a plurality of protrusions for disrupting debris located along a pool body. The leading edge member is suspended between a pair of extension arms which also are connected to the frame. A tensioning mechanism is positioned between each arm and the frame and secures the leading edge at a resting location that is above the frame and net.
CLEANING WATER TANK AND CLEANING DEVICE
A cleaning water tank includes a water tank housing and a switch assembly. The water tank housing includes a water storage cavity, a water injection port in a side of the water tank housing, and a water outlet in a bottom of the water tank housing. The water injection port and the water outlet are both communicated with the water storage cavity. The switch assembly is movably arranged to the water tank housing. The water storage cavity is configured to be isolated from an outside air, when the switch assembly is in a closed position, and the water storage cavity is configured to be communicated with the outside air to form a pressure difference, when the switch assembly is in an open position, to allow water in the water storage cavity to be discharged from the water tank housing via the water outlet under the action of the pressure difference.

Self-cleaning tank
A tank, such as a fermentation tank, includes a scraper blade assembly slideably coupled to a bottom surface of the tank. The scraper blade assembly includes a blade arranged to displace solids deposited on the bottom surface of the tank out through an aperture arranged flush with the bottom surface of the tank.

Method and apparatus for cleaning the interior of an above ground storage tank
An apparatus and method for cleaning the interior of an above ground storage tank includes a nozzle assembly mounted to a cover on the storage tank sidewall having a horizontally extending wash pipe fixedly and a suction pipe for recirculation of spent fluids. The wash pipe has an interior segment which can be extended to a tank floor and is configured with a bend to extend along the tank sidewall to which is attached a submersible swivel joint fitted with a choked nozzle. The nozzle assembly is attached to a control assembly so that the direction of flow from the nozzle may be manipulated by rotation of the swivel joint from the exterior of the storage tank. The nozzle also may be adjusted so the direction of flow may follow the angle of the tank floor.
Cleaning Brush Structure for Washing Machine
A cleaning brush structure is applicable for a washing machine, and the washing machine contains: a body in which an external drum is mounted, and the external drum accommodates an internal drum having a plurality of through orifices. Each of the plurality of through orifices accommodates a cleaning brush which includes a fixing element and a brushing element, and the fixing element has a conical face formed on a peripheral wall thereof, a small-diameter segment arranged on a first end thereof, and a large-diameter segment arranged on a second end thereof opposite to the first end of the fixing element. The brushing element is mounted on the small-diameter segment of the fixing element and has bristles inserted through said each through orifice so that the fixing element is fixed in said each through orifice of the internal drum.

Coating apparatus comprising a cleaning arrangement
A cleaning arrangement (200) for a coating apparatus (100). The coating apparatus has a base (123) for carrying loose material. The base is rotatable to coat the loose material. The cleaning arrangement includes a base-scraping arrangement (127) and further includes a mounting arrangement (131) by which the base-scraping arrangement is mounted to be reversibly lowered, from a coating position, to a scraping position at which the base-scraping arrangement is positioned to scrape buildup from the base.
